A beaker contains 25 mL of 0.80M propylamine (C3H7NH2; Kb =5.1*10^-4)
a.) Is propylamine classified as a weak or strong, acid or base?Write the equation showing the equilibrium established bypropylamine in water?
b.) Solid C3H7NH3Br is added to the 0.80M C3H7NH2 solution. Writethe equation showing the ionization of the C3H7NH3Br. Does thisequation proceed 100% to completion? What is the identity of thecommon ion?
c.) How does the addition of this common ion to the 0.80M C3H7NH2affect (increases, decreases, remains the same) each of thefollowing? Explain.
1.)[H3O+] 2.)pH 3.)[C3H7NH2] 4.) % ionization of C3HNH2 5.)[OH-]
d.) Will addition of solid KBr to the 0.80M C3H7NH2 affect the pHand [H3O+]? Why or why not?
